Michael Jordan’s wife gives birth to twin daughters

Michael Jordan had a lot to celebrate on Tuesday night.

His wife, Yvette, has given birth to the couple’s identical twin daughters, Jordan’s spokeswoman Estee Portnoy told The Associated Press.

Portnoy said Tuesday night Yvette Jordan, 35, gave birth to Victoria and Ysabel on Sunday in West Palm Beach, Florida.

“Yvette Jordan and the babies are doing well and the family is overjoyed at their arrival,” Portnoy said.

Jordan is the owner of the NBA’s Charlotte Bobcats, who are currently the eighth seed in the Eastern Conference and have a chance to make the postseason for the first time since he took over as majority owner in 2010.

Jordan, who turns 51 next Monday, married former model Yvette Prieto on April 27 of last year in Palm Beach, Fla. The reception took place at a private golf club in Jupiter, Fla., designed by Jack Nicklaus. Jordan owns a home near the course.

The couple met six years ago at a Miami night club.

Jordan has three children — two sons, Jeffrey Michael and Marcus James, and a daughter, Jasmine — with former wife Juanita Vanoy. They divorced in 2006.

Miss Piggy to marry Kermit in Vivienne Westwood-designed gown

It seems that Miss Piggy’s dream of a white wedding may come true as Vivienne Westwood designs a dress for her the next Muppets film.

The top fashion designer has created an ivory gown for the upcoming Disney film Muppets Most Wanted.

The film, starring Tina Fey and Ricky Gervais, features the characters on a mayhem-filled grand tour of Europe.

Miss Piggy, who wears the ivory couture wedding gown, has been trying to convince Kermit the Frog to marry her for years.

But film bosses have not revealed whether fans will see them finally manage to tie the knot.

“Vivienne Westwood is fabulous-just like moi,” said Miss Piggy.

“When I asked her to design this wedding dress for moi’s new movie…, she was thrilled and I was thrilled. The only one a bit ‘iffy’ about it was the frog.”

The gown, teamed up with an ivory tulle veil, has “corset detailing and paillettes made from recycled plastic bottles”.

British designer Westwood spoke about the gown in the March issue of US Harper’s Bazaar.

She said: “The dress is one of my favourite styles. It’s called the Court dress and is inspired by 17th Century English royalty and the court of King Charles II.

“It has been designed especially …in a white pearl sequin fabric made from recycled water bottles. It’s the perfect choice for a royal sow.”

He was born five months ago and the world has been waiting for their first glimpse of Halle Berry’s baby son Maceo.

That glimpse happened on Monday when the little boy’s nanny took him to visit his famous mother at work.

Maceo, whose father is Halle’s husband Olivier Martinez, has chubby cheeks and a head of thick black hair, and all in all is extremely adorable.

The baby has an exotic heritage, as Halle has African American, English and German roots while Olivier was born to a Spanish Moroccan father and French mother.

Maceo was brought to the Los Angeles set of Halle’s new TV show Extant for a visit, where the star and everyone else working on the programme promptly fawned over him.

Dressed in a cosy yellow jumper, grey leggings and white shoes, it’s hardly a surprise that the tot brought such a big smile to his mother’s face.

Halle, who is in great shape following the birth, crouched down to be at the same level as Maceo’s stroller and couldn’t help but coo while gazing tenderly at him.
